Subject: Sweeper cut-over complete

Hi all — welcome to the team, and here's where things stand. Last night we cut the data-retention sweeper over from the legacy Harkwell batch job to the new Tidewane service. All three retention policies were re-verified against the compliance matrix, and the dry-run deletions matched expectations exactly. Legacy job is disabled but not deleted for two weeks, per rollback policy. For reference, the new sweeper runs in production with the following configuration values.

config for kafof-bawef:
holath:
  log_level: debug
  metrics_host: metrics.holath.qorvelsys.internal
  pin: 2191
  pool_size: 32

Welcome to the Ledgerline platform team. As a contractor on the conversion service, you'll frequently touch our rounding logic. All currency conversions must use banker's rounding at the final step only — never round intermediate values, or small discrepancies will compound across multi-leg conversions. To verify your changes against production rates, you'll call the internal RateProof service from your sandbox. Authenticate each request with the key below.

gateway credential: kto3_qfe

## Authentication

As part of the Hallovar ORM refactor, the data-access layer now authenticates to the internal query gateway instead of holding raw database credentials. This narrows the blast radius of any compromised service and centralizes audit logging. For the security review, a read-scoped credential has been provisioned. Configure your review harness with the key below.

app token of tagef-tafog = qvz3-7n0

## v1.12.0 — Signing key rotation

Quick one for review: FeedProof, our podcast feed validator, now signs its validation reports with a fresh key after the old one hit its one-year limit. I've updated the verifier config, the CI fixtures, and the docs in one pass — sorry for the diff size, most of it is regenerated test signatures. Old reports stay verifiable against the archived key for ninety days. The new active signing key follows.

release key, hadug-kawef: bky13_mPGeFZeR1GZ1G